Solar cookers with storage are classified according to the two main types of TES technologies which are; sensible heat thermal energy storage (SHTES) and latent heat thermal energy storage (LHTES).

A review of parabolic solar cookers with thermal energy storage

1.2. Thermal energy storage for solar cookers Simple solar cookers can be used only when the sun is available as they cannot operate at night, during cloudy days, or when it is raining. However, thermal energy storage (TES) offers a solution for this mismatch between solar energy supply and demand. Combining solar

Solar cooking innovations, their appropriateness, and viability

Energy storage for solar cooking. Cooking in the early morning or the evening requires a large capacity heat storage material. In a PV-based cooker, this can be provided through the batteries whilst in solar thermal cookers by using a potential thermal storage material such as a phase change material (Saxena et al. 2011). Analysis of Energy storage system for Cooking | SpringerLink

From the literature survey, it is observed that the solar cooker is more reliable with the use of energy storage systems. This paper presents the analysis of the solar cookers with an energy storage system. This study has been performed by using a latent energy storage system with two-phase change materials which are paraffin wax and HDPE.

Nano-thermal energy storage system for application in solar

The TES system can hold enough heat energy to meet cooking needs for three days. Long-term cost savings are provided by the solar cooking stove, even though the initial investment is marginally higher than that of an LPG stove. The solar cooking stove with a TES system is expected to cost Rs. 25 000, but it will pay for itself in 2–3 years.
